Ticket VLT-442. Vault for the Mixwright recipe-scaling calculator is locked out after three bad attempts. You're the new contractor, so: do not reset the vault. The scaling coefficients and unit-conversion tables live in there; losing them means re-deriving everything from the Tarnholm test kitchen notes. Steps: stop the calculator service, open the vault client, choose recovery mode, confirm with the on-call lead. When prompted, enter the recovery passphrase shown below.

unlock words, hahip-yagef: zorok-novmir-zorix-silax

Subject: Hollenbeck Partners Term Sheet — Board Review

Dear Executive Team,

We have received the revised term sheet from Hollenbeck Partners regarding the proposed distribution agreement for the Calyra product line. Key changes include a longer exclusivity window, revised minimum volume commitments, and a revenue share adjusted in our favor after year two. Legal has flagged two clauses for further negotiation, and I recommend we respond within ten business days. Before the board votes, please note the following sensitive context.

management briefing: Project Ulavan slips by two quarters because of the staffing delay.

The Gatecount turnstile counter at Harlow Pitch Arena aggregates entry pulses every five seconds and publishes totals to the Tallyline bus. Plugin authors must never write directly to the counter table; instead, subscribe to the delta stream and reconcile against the hourly snapshot. If your plugin detects a gap larger than 200 pulses, raise a soft alert rather than resetting the counter, since resets cascade to capacity dashboards. To authenticate your plugin against the Tallyline ingestion endpoint, use the internal key provided below.

API key for yahig-tadup: kto7_ubizbYm

**Audit item: crash-report pipeline (Lanternfall mobile).** Verify that crash reports from both the Android and iOS builds land in the Cinderbeam intake within five minutes of app restart. Confirm symbolication completes for the latest release, dedup rules are firing, and no events are stuck in the retry queue. Check that alert thresholds match the values agreed at last week's sync, and that the on-call dashboard reflects the current build numbers. Any gaps found during the audit should be routed to the pipeline owner.

signatory, kaweg-fawig: Zorys Druys Jorius Novael